News & MediaCanada Post Strike
Important Message for the Life & Health Insurance Clients

June 3, 2011

Canada Post and the Canadian Union of Postal Workers (CUPW) are in the process of negotiating a new labour contract.  As a rotating strike is currently underway, we are working closely with financial security advisor, group insurance broker or consultant in order to keep service interruptions to a minimum.
Here are some helpful answers to FAQs:

I usually mail my cheque. How would I make my payment?

For individual insurance (life, critical illness, accident & sickness), you can easily change your payment method to a pre-authorized payment. To do so, complete the Pre-authorized Debit form and fax it to AXA along with a copy of a void cheque to 1 866 682-6825.

To know the withdrawal amount or for any other questions regarding individual insurance, you can contact either you financial security advisor or our Insured Service at 1 800 565-4550.

If you have questions regarding group insurance premium payments, please contact your group insurance broker or consultant, or our Premium Collection Team at 1 800 561-7251 ext.3260.

Despite the Canada Post conflict, will I still receive documents regarding my contract?

To get a print-out of your contract documents, please contact your advisor, group insurance broker or consultant.

How will I receive my claim cheque?

Procedures have been put in place to ensure that you receive your cheque, either by courier or through your financial security advisor, group insurance broker or consultant.

For all other inquiries relating to your insurance coverage or contract documentation, please contact your Advisor, group insurance broker or consultant.

We will continue to monitor the situation very closely and will let you know if any other steps need to be taken to ensure that our distribution services continue to run smoothly.

About AXA

Present across Canada, AXA offers a complete line of property/casualty and life and health insurance products to its clients through its 2,300 employees and some 4,000 brokers and advisors. In 2009, AXA had revenues of C$2.05 billion and a net profit of C$137.6 million. AXA in Canada is a member of the AXA Group, a world leader in financial protection operating mainly in Western Europe, North America and the Asia/Pacific region. Around the world, 96 million clients place their trust in AXA.
